Diesel misappropriation: 17,460 litres seized, 3 held

The Domestic Trade and Cost of Living Ministry (KPDN) conducted a raid in Masjid Tanah, Melaka, uncovering the suspected misappropriation of 17,460 litres of diesel. Three men were arrested during the operation, which involved nine enforcement officers from Putrajaya and Melaka KPDN enforcement divisions. The investigation, conducted around 9am, targeted a fenced premises in Kampung Paya Mengkuang used for illegal storage and transfer of diesel.

Authorities seized 17,460 litres of diesel, a skid tank, two tanker lorries, a cargo lorry, five mobile phones, and several documents. A notice under Section 8(1) of the Supply Control Act 1961 was issued, requiring the declaration of the stock and submission of relevant documents.
